Naga Munchetty Biography

Naga Munchetty is a British television presenter, news anchor as well as a journalist whereby she hosts BBC Breakfast on a regular basis. She has previously hosted BBC World News and BBC Two’s weekday financial affairs show Working Lunch.

Munchetty began her television career as a reporter for Reuters Financial Television, then went on to work for CNBC Europe as a senior producer, Channel 4 News as a business producer and reporter, and Bloomberg Television as a presenter. She joined Working Lunch after it was relaunched in October 2008, and stayed with it till it was canceled in July 2010.

Munchetty has hosted Money Box on Radio 4. She also contributes to BBC News from the City, where she gauges public reaction to major financial stories such as the Budget and the Pre-Budget Report. She has been presenting early morning briefings (UKT) on the BBC News Channel and BBC World News since August 2010. She is frequently on BBC One’s Breakfast program.

She took over as host of the 10 a.m. to 1 p.m. Radio 5 shows on Mondays and Wednesdays from January 2021, replacing Emma Barnett, who moved to Radio 4’s Woman’s Hour. She and Sally Taylor co-hosted The Spending Review – The South Today Debate on BBC One in September 2010.

Munchetty is a jazz trumpeter who also plays classical piano. She enjoys golf and has a nine-hole handicap in 2015. She won the Hertfordshire de Paula Cup at Bishop’s Stortford Golf Club in October 2012.

Naga Munchetty Family

Munchetty was born and raised by her parents in Streatham, South London. Her mother is an Indian whereas her father is a Mauritian.

She did her early education at Graveney School in Tooting. She later studied English Literature and Language at the University of Leeds and graduated in 1997.

Naga Munchetty Illness

In September 2022, Naga received a diagnosis of adenomyosis and shared this news with her audience during her BBC Radio 5 Live show in May 2023.
